What is Pulmonary fibrosis and Why It Needs Attention?
Pulmonary fibrosis is a chronic and progressive lung disease characterised by the scarring and thickening of lung tissue. This scarring makes it increasingly difficult for the lungs to transfer oxygen into the bloodstream. Common Causes of Pulmonary fibrosis
The most frequent primary cause of Pulmonary fibrosis: In many cases, the specific cause of Pulmonary fibrosis is unknown; this is referred to as idiopathic Pulmonary fibrosis (IPF).
The most common secondary cause of Pulmonary fibrosis: Certain autoimmune diseases, such as rheumatoid arthritis, scleroderma, and lupus, can increase the risk of developing Pulmonary fibrosis.
An important lifestyle or environmental trigger for Pulmonary fibrosis: Exposure to environmental pollutants, including silica dust, asbestos, and certain organic dusts (common in some construction or industrial settings around Visakhapatnam), can contribute to the development of Pulmonary fibrosis.
Symptoms of Pulmonary fibrosis That Need Medical Attention
The most concerning symptom of Pulmonary fibrosis: Progressive shortness of breath, especially with exertion, is a hallmark symptom that should prompt immediate concern.
A symptom indicating the condition is worsening: A persistent dry cough that doesn’t improve with over-the-counter remedies suggests that the condition may be worsening and needs to be assessed by a specialist.
A symptom that requires immediate medical help: Sudden, severe shortness of breath accompanied by chest pain or bluish discolouration of the lips or fingers (cyanosis) requires immediate medical attention.
Diagnosing Pulmonary fibrosis and When to Seek Medical Help
Diagnosing Pulmonary fibrosis involves a thorough medical history, a physical examination, and several diagnostic tests. Your doctor will ask about your symptoms, past medical conditions, and potential exposures to environmental irritants. During the physical exam, they will listen to your lungs for specific sounds. Diagnostic tests may include a chest X-ray, a high-resolution CT scan, pulmonary function tests to measure lung capacity, and possibly a lung biopsy. If you are experiencing persistent shortness of breath, a chronic dry cough, unexplained fatigue, or clubbing of the fingers (a widening and rounding of the fingertips), it's important to seek medical attention. Pulmonary fibrosis Treatments and Remedies
Effective Pulmonary fibrosis treatment in Visakhapatnam aims to slow the progression of the disease, manage symptoms, and improve quality of life. Treatment plans are tailored to the individual's specific needs and may include a combination of medical treatments, home remedies, and lifestyle changes.
Medical treatments: Prescription medications, such as pirfenidone and nintedanib, can help slow the progression of Pulmonary fibrosis. Pulmonary rehabilitation programs can improve breathing and exercise tolerance. Oxygen therapy can help relieve shortness of breath and improve oxygen levels in the blood. In severe cases, a lung transplant may be considered.
Home remedies: Practising breathing exercises, such as pursed-lip breathing, can help improve lung function. Staying hydrated by drinking plenty of fluids can help thin mucus and ease breathing. Avoiding exposure to irritants, such as smoke, dust, and pollutants, is also vital. Ensuring adequate rest and pacing activities to avoid overexertion can help manage fatigue.
Lifestyle changes: Quitting smoking is crucial, as smoking accelerates the progression of Pulmonary fibrosis. Maintaining a healthy weight can reduce strain on the lungs. Regular exercise, within your capabilities, can help improve overall fitness and lung function. Getting vaccinated against influenza and pneumonia can help prevent respiratory infections, which can worsen Pulmonary fibrosis.
